离子束轰击对SnO2超微粒子薄膜性质的影响

摘    要:采用直流气放电活化反应蒸发法,沉积成SnO2超微粒子薄膜。以不同能量的离子束轰击薄膜表面,用扫描电子显微镜、俄歇电子能谱仪等,分析了离子束作用对SnO2UPF表面形貌和化学组成的影响,同时研究了离子束作用前后,SnO2UPF对乙醇的气敏性质的变化。

Influence of Iron Beam Bombardment on the Properties of SnO_2 Ultrafine Particle Films

Abstract:SnO_2 ultrafine particle films were deposited by d.c. gas discharge activating reaction evaporation. The ion beams with various energy were used to bombard the SnO_2 UPF.Influence of ion beam bombardment on the SnO_2 UPF surface morphology and chemical composition was analysed by SEM and AES. The gas sensing properties of SnO_2 UPF to C_2H_5OH gas before and after being bombarded were also studied.
